Welcome to the fourth installment of our RotoWire Roundtable 2025 fantasy football rankings.

Below are our top-150 composite NFL fantasy rankings from RotoWire football writers Jeff Erickson, Mario Puig, Jim Coventry and Jerry Donabedian.

Rankings are based on PPR scoring for single-QB leagues. For each player, we've listed average rank (AV) and median rank (MED), along with each writer's rank.

Click on a column to sort. The default order is median ranking.

Since our last update, the top 10 had slight movement. CeeDee Lamb jumped Justin Jefferson to No. 5, Ashton Jeanty jumped Malik Nabers to No. 8 and Brian Thomas jumped Nico Collins to get back into the top 10.

Puka Nacua, who ranked ninth a month ago, continues to slide on the news (or lack thereof) of Matthew Stafford's injury. He's now down to 15th. 

The other big mover this time is Quinshon Judkins, who moved from 130 to 103. (Jerome Ford held steady.) Judkins covered a wide range among our rankers. Erickson moved him to 99 (from 153), Puig kept him at 123, Coventry moved him to 65 (127) and Donabedian moved Judkins to 109 (131).
